On Bali’s Bukit Peninsula, Garuda Wisnu Kencana Cultural Park centers on the large Garuda-Vishnu statue and stages Balinese dance, concerts, and cultural exhibitions with views toward Jimbaran.
Garuda Wisnu Kencana Cultural Park is a cultural complex on the Bukit peninsula of southern Bali centered on a monumental sculptural ensemble of the god Vishnu mounted on Garuda. The site functions as both a civic cultural park and a venue for staged performances and exhibitions.
The park offers formal landscaped areas, an amphitheater, exhibition halls and viewing terraces that present the statue and host cultural events such as dance, music and ceremonies. Visitors use the terraces and platforms for panoramas across the surrounding Bukit landscape toward the southern coastline.
The project was developed as a private cultural complex to celebrate Indonesian mythology and Balinese arts and has been constructed in stages over recent decades. The park now operates as a visitor attraction with scheduled cultural programs and public access to the main sculptural works.
The complex is located in the Ungasan/Bukit area of Badung Regency in southern Bali, within reasonable driving distance of Denpasar, Jimbaran and southern resort areas.

What to See #
- Garuda Wisnu Kencana statue: The monumental statue complex depicting the Hindu god Vishnu riding the mythical bird Garuda, which forms the visual and symbolic centre of the park.
- Amphitheater and performance areas: An amphitheater and performance pavilions used for cultural events, concerts and traditional Balinese performances within the park grounds.
How to Get to Garuda Wisnu Kencana Cultural Park #
Located in Ungasan, southern Bali. Drive or hire a taxi from Kuta (approx. 30-45 minutes depending on traffic). Some tour operators include GWK as part of temple and cultural day trips.
Tips for Visiting Garuda Wisnu Kencana Cultural Park #
- Go for the late-afternoon light at the Garuda statue for dramatic sunset photos.
- Combine a visit with a cultural performance scheduled by the park - the Balinese kecak or traditional dance adds context.
- Expect crowds during holiday periods and plan early or late visits to avoid bus groups.
Best Time to Visit Garuda Wisnu Kencana Cultural Park #
Dry season is best for outdoor sculpture viewing and performances; evenings are busy with sunset visitors.
Weather & Climate near Garuda Wisnu Kencana Cultural Park #
Garuda Wisnu Kencana Cultural Park's climate is classified as Tropical Monsoon - Tropical Monsoon climate with consistently warm temperatures year-round. Temperatures range from 22°C to 30°C. Abundant rainfall (1869 mm/year), wettest in January with a pronounced dry season.
